Moodle PHP Documentation 5.1
Moodle 5.1dev (Build: 20250605) (9223e346c3e)
tool_licensemanager\output\renderer Class Reference

Renderer class for 'tool_licensemanager' component. More...

Inheritance diagram for tool_licensemanager\output\renderer:

Public Member Functions

 render_create_licence_headers ()
 Render the headers for create license form.
 
 render_edit_licence_headers (string $licenseshortname)
 Render the headers for edit license form.
 
 render_table (\renderable $table)
 Render the license manager table.
 

Detailed Description

Renderer class for 'tool_licensemanager' component.

License
http://www.gnu.org/copyleft/gpl.html GNU GPL v3 or later

Member Function Documentation

◆ render_create_licence_headers()

tool_licensemanager\output\renderer::render_create_licence_headers ( )

Render the headers for create license form.

Return values
stringhtml fragment for display.

◆ render_edit_licence_headers()

tool_licensemanager\output\renderer::render_edit_licence_headers ( string $licenseshortname)

Render the headers for edit license form.

Parameters
string$licenseshortnamethe shortname of license to edit.
Return values
stringhtml fragment for display.

◆ render_table()

tool_licensemanager\output\renderer::render_table ( \renderable $table)

Render the license manager table.

Parameters
renderable$tablethe renderable.
Return values
stringHTML.

The documentation for this class was generated from the following file: